Leave a Comment »Fresh Ink Online Presents: Brian Michael Bendis Interview
Dig this 2-part Fresh Ink Online special where host Blair Butler chats with comic book legend Brian Michael Bendis at Golden Apple Comics in Hollywood.
In Part 1, they chat about the evolution of Spiderwoman, from The Avengers to his upcoming print and motion comic editions, which leads to a spirited discussion of comics going digital via Kindle, iTunes, and Apple or Microsoft tablets. What does the future hold for comic books, and does going digital represent the death of print media?
In Part 2, Blair and Brian chat about the evolution of intellectual property and creator-owned books. They get into the history of bringing Bendis' acclaimed comic Torso to the big screen, and he gives insight into consulting on the Iron Man movie and being part of the Marvel creative committee. You’ll also get juicy details on the Powers TV pilot for FX, plus updates on Kenneth Branagh’s upcoming Thor movie and the upcoming Avengers movie. In addition, Brian talks about the re-launch of Powers on November 27 and the December launch of Marvel’s 4-issue mini-series Siege, which kicks off with the Siege of the Cabal debut issue, unites Thor, Iron Man and Captain America, and marks a seismic shift in the Avengers books via the end of the Dark Reign plot. Leave a Comment »Fresh Ink Online: Interview With Gerard Way (My Chemical Romance, Umbrella Academy)
Hey, gang! Host Blair Butler is out this week on a rare vacation. Yes, even Blair gets to take some time off once in a while. So instead of a new episode of Fresh Ink Online, we are running this awesome interview with My Chemical Romance frontman Gerard Way.
Of course, in addition to being a big rock star, Gerard is a superb illustrator and writer, and the man behind the terrific comic The Umbrella Academy (Dark Horse Comics). We here at Fresh Ink Online are always thrilled when he stops by, and this is a very special opportunity to get inside his head.
In Part 1 of this sit-down chat, Gerard talks about how he became involved in the comic book world, who his influences and collaborators are, and how the surprise success of the band nearly pulled him away from his true passion, comics.
In Part 2, he chats in depth with Blair about The Umbrella Academy, how it came to be and where it’s going. He also discusses upcoming comic projects and what’s next for My Chemical Romance.
This is fascinating stuff from a man who truly wears many, many hats. Of course, he is not actually wearing a hat here, per se, but you get the picture.
